1-(2-FLUORO-5-(TRIFLUOROMETHYL)PHENYL)ETHANOL synthesis

1synthesis methods
-

Yield:-

Reaction Conditions:

Stage #1: methylmagnesium bromide;2-fluoro-5-trifluoromethylbenzaldehyde in tetrahydrofuran at 0 - 20; for 0.5 h;
Stage #2: with ammonium chloride in tetrahydrofuran;water;

Steps:

29.1

3.0 M methylmagnesiumbromide (7.8 ml) was dropped, in a nitrogen atmosphere at 0 °C, into the THF (30 ml) solution of 2-fluoro-5-trifluoromethyl benzaldehyde (3.0 g). After the mixture was warmed to room temperature, and was then stirred for 30 minutes, it was poured into a saturated ammonium chloride aqueous solution, and was then subjected to extraction with ethyl acetate. After its organic layer was washed with brine, and was then dried with anhydrous magnesium sulfate, it was filtered, and was then concentrated under reduced pressure to produce a crude chemical compound (58) (3.42 g).
